What is number of distinct actions of the group $\mathbb{Z}$ on the set $\{1, 2, 3, 4\}$?
Here my understanding is, for the group action there will be a permutation representative such that
$$\phi: \mathbb{Z}\rightarrow S_4$$
And to know the number of distinct group action I need to know how many possible $\phi$s are there.
Now, I am confused, how I can determine the the number of $\phi$, or am I going in wrong direction?
